Die Wittgensteiner Familiendatei » Elisabeth Balthasar (1649-1714)

Personal data Elisabeth Balthasar 


Household of Elisabeth Balthasar

She is married to Christian Georg Rumpf.

Ehelich: Ja
Quellen: ChrnGg Rumpf, Sv HWilh +, Rentmeister, Laa, & AElis Baltzer, Tv Johs, Oberförster
21.05.1666 (Verzeichnis junger angehender Eheleute, WA-W 51)

They got married on January 2, 1667 at Laasphe, Kreis Wittgenstein.

Band 03, 178/10

Child(ren):

  1. Sibylle Rumpf  1667-????
  2. Elisabeth Rumpf  1672-1708
  3. Georg Rumpf  1684-????
  4. Jakob Rumpf  1679-????
  5. Luise Rumpf  1676-????
  6. Agnes Rumpf  1670-1718 
  7. Christine Rumpf  ± 1669-???? 
  8. Christian Rumpf  1672-1726
